Transaction 88172c2de16d96dc70b25f704f605ccdf043c6febb5ad4397588fbf25ed20c44
2 Input
2 Outputs
- 88172c2de16d96dc70b25f704f605ccdf043c6febb5ad4397588fbf25ed20c44:0
- 88172c2de16d96dc70b25f704f605ccdf043c6febb5ad4397588fbf25ed20c44:1
value 20000000
address 35piyu3HLkFd8YKr2uv8ifAS6KFWuCW9ok
value 7683992
address 125rtS1ZhuwVDHZSvM1xBq8twwRzxz4BFG